## Artifact Signing — LexiPull Extraction Script

Plugin authors shipping translation bundles via LexiPull must sign the extracted string archive before upload. Run `lexipull extract --bundle` then `lexipull sign` against the output. Unsigned archives are rejected by the Quellhaus registry. The registry verifies every archive against the key below.

rollout seal: bky4_x7Gc

## Tuning

Deploybot polls the Harkwell release API and posts status to chat. Polling intervals, backoff, and message rate caps are the main attack-surface-relevant knobs: too aggressive and we amplify load during incidents; too lax and stale status leaks into decisions. All values are validated at startup and logged. Review the constants below before approving changes.

tuning table, kajog-bawip:
TIERS = {
    "kelius": 256,
    "lammir": 543,
}

Subject: Quickstore 4.2 — bloom filter now fronts the KV layer

Plugin authors: starting with this release, Quickstore places a bloom filter ahead of the key-value store. Negative lookups return faster; false positives fall through safely. No API changes are required on your side. Verify your plugin against the staging build referenced below.

session token of fahif-tadup = htk3_9c7

Welcome to the Snackline team. The restock planner computes weekly routes for our vending fleet by pulling inventory telemetry from each machine and weighting it against historical sellout data. Before running it locally, clone the planner repo, install dependencies, and copy the sample env file into your working directory. The planner will refuse to start without a valid signing credential for the telemetry gateway, which must appear on its own line. Place that entry at the bottom of your env file now.

sealed setting: RELAY_SECRET5=82864

Action item from the Quillhaven descriptor-leak investigation: Marisol will add periodic FD accounting to the `sockjanitor` daemon so we catch leaks before the kernel limit is hit, rather than after connection failures cascade. The root cause was an error path in the retry wrapper that skipped `close()` on timed-out uploads. To make the new watchdog's behavior reproducible across staging and prod, we agreed on the following thresholds:

tuning table, faweg-bajep:
WEIGHTS = {
    "belius": 690,
    "eliox": 458,
    "norax": 616,
    "praion": 132,
    "zorvan": 911,
}